What is Vinyl Wrap and Why is it Essential for UTV Owners?
Vinyl wrap is a type of material made from polyvinyl chloride (PVC) that is used to cover and protect the surface of various items, including vehicles, walls, and furniture. In the context of UTV (Utility Task Vehicle) owners, vinyl wrap serves both a functional and aesthetic purpose, allowing for customization while providing a protective layer against the elements and physical damage.
According to the Specialty Graphic Imaging Association (SGIA), vinyl wraps are a popular choice for vehicle customization due to their versatility and durability. The application of high-quality vinyl can enhance the appearance of a UTV and safeguard its original paint from scratches, UV rays, and other environmental factors, thereby extending the vehicle’s lifespan.
Key aspects of vinyl wrap include its ease of application and removal, as well as the wide variety of colors and finishes available, ranging from matte to glossy and even textures that mimic materials like carbon fiber. High-quality vinyl wraps are designed to conform to the surface of the vehicle, ensuring that every contour is covered. Furthermore, these wraps are often resistant to fading and peeling, making them an ideal choice for UTVs that are frequently used in rugged outdoor environments.
The impact of using vinyl wrap on UTVs can be significant. Not only does it enhance the visual appeal of the vehicle, but it also protects the underlying paint from damage that could occur during off-road adventures. A well-maintained exterior can improve the resale value of the UTV, making it a wise investment for owners. Additionally, a vibrant and personalized wrap can help a UTV stand out in a crowd, which is particularly beneficial for those who participate in events or competitions.
Statistics show that the vehicle wrapping industry has seen a steady growth rate, with a projected increase of 4.1% annually through 2025, indicating a rising trend among vehicle owners to opt for wraps instead of traditional paint jobs. This trend is also fueled by the increasing awareness of the protective benefits that vinyl wraps offer, such as safeguarding against scratches and UV damage.
The benefits of vinyl wrap for UTV owners include the ability to customize their vehicles without the permanence of paint, the protection of the vehicle’s surface, and potentially lower costs compared to a full paint job. UTV owners are encouraged to choose high-quality vinyl from reputable manufacturers to ensure longevity and durability. Best practices include proper surface preparation before application, using heat to assist in conforming the vinyl to the UTV’s contours, and regular maintenance to keep the wrap in optimal condition.

How Does Durability Impact Your Choice of Vinyl Wrap?
The durability of vinyl wrap is a crucial factor when selecting the best vinyl wrap for UTVs, as it affects both performance and longevity.
- Material Quality: High-quality vinyl wraps are made from premium materials that resist fading, cracking, and peeling. This means they can withstand harsh outdoor conditions, including UV exposure and moisture, ensuring that the wrap remains vibrant and intact over time.
- Thickness: The thickness of the vinyl wrap can greatly impact its durability. Thicker wraps tend to be more resilient against scratches and tears, making them ideal for off-road vehicles that may encounter rough terrains and obstacles.
- Adhesive Strength: The type of adhesive used in the vinyl wrap plays a significant role in its durability. Strong adhesive ensures that the wrap adheres well to the UTV surface, preventing it from lifting or bubbling, especially during extreme weather conditions.
- Environmental Resistance: Vinyl wraps that are designed to resist environmental factors such as water, dirt, and chemicals will last longer. This is particularly important for UTVs that are often used in muddy or wet environments, as it minimizes the risk of deterioration.
- Warranty and Brand Reputation: Choosing a vinyl wrap from a reputable brand that offers a warranty can be an indicator of durability. Brands that stand behind their products typically use high-quality materials and manufacturing processes, which can lead to a longer-lasting wrap.
What Finishes Are Available for Vinyl Wraps on UTVs?
| Finish Type | Description |
|---|---|
| Gloss Finish | High shine, reflective surface that enhances colors and details. Popular for a vibrant look. Ideal for show vehicles and personal customization. Offers moderate durability against scratches and fading. |
| Matte Finish | Smooth, non-reflective surface offering a stealthy, modern appearance. Great for a subtle look. Often used in military applications or for a more understated style. Provides good durability but can show fingerprints and smudges more easily. |
| Satin Finish | Between gloss and matte, providing a soft sheen. Balances brightness and muted tones. Suitable for both casual and professional settings. Offers decent durability and is less prone to showing wear than gloss. |
| Textured Finish | Features a tactile surface, often used for a rugged look. Can mimic materials like carbon fiber. Offers added grip and is popular for off-road vehicles. Highly durable and resistant to scratches, ideal for heavy use. |
